Correlation

The correlation between MNT.TO and XUU-U.TO is 0.13, which is low. Their price movements are largely independent, making them effective diversification partners.

Volatility

MNT.TO vs. XUU-U.TO - Volatility Comparison

Royal Canadian Mint - Canadian Gold Reserves (MNT.TO) has a higher volatility of 8.91% compared to iShares Core S&P U.S. Total Market Index ETF (XUU-U.TO) at 4.52%. This indicates that MNT.TO's price experiences larger fluctuations and is considered to be riskier than XUU-U.TO based on this measure.
